Space-saving

Sectionals are more flexible and fit into smaller spaces. The L-shaped sections are great for corner spaces and are able to accommodate several people for family movie nights as well as casual gatherings. The shape also allows them to function as subtle room dividers in open-plan houses without obstructing views.

It is crucial to choose the correct sectional for your home in order to have an enjoyable seating arrangement. Take into consideration the dimensions of your space, along with other furniture and the flow of traffic. You'll want to ensure that there is enough space for the sofa to move around, and that it fits into your design scheme.

Some sectionals are pre-determined, while others are modular. This allows you to arrange the seating in any way you prefer. Some sectionals are equipped with additional features like built-in recliners or storage. Some models can be adjusted in height so that they can accommodate people of all age groups.

Comfort

A sectional is a great option when you are looking for the right seating solution for your living room. It provides maximum seating, while taking up less space than a traditional loveseat or sofa. It comes in a variety of sizes and styles. It can also be fitted with a chaise, or ottoman to provide flexibility and comfort.

When choosing an l shaped sectional, take into account the overall comfort of the design and also your lifestyle and personal aesthetics. Numerous manufacturers offer a wide selection of options for upholstery, from soft leather to slick linen. The fabric you select can influence the look and feel of your sofa and also the durability and maintenance requirements. For instance, if you have pets or children, a stain-resistant fabric may be better suited for your requirements than a light color or delicate fabric that can easily be damaged by pet hair or food spills.

It is also important to consider the structural integrity of the sectional. To ensure strength and stability, a quality brand will make use of wooden frames that have been kiln dried. This will allow the sofa to stand up to years of use and constant entertaining. Certain brands also employ sinuous springs to give support and enhance the comfort of your seating.

It is also important to consider your budget when buying a sectional. The cost of a sofa sectional is determined by its size, materials, and features. A bigger sectional will typically be more expensive than one that is smaller. Additionally, a sectional with reclining seats will cost more than one that doesn't.
